Mission Statement:
People First
of Nevada is a Self-Advocacy Group run by people with
developmental differences throughout Nevada. As citizens of
Nevada, we have the right to make our own decisions and to
live self-determined lives.


People
First of Nevada’s goals are to:
- To live lives based on the principles of self-determination: Freedom, Authority, Support, Responsibility and Confirmation
- To have adequate transportation, especially in rural areas
- To have affordable, accessible housing in the community with supports needed to live independently
- To have competitive employment opportunities in the community with adequate supports to be successful
- To have inclusive education for people with disabilities of all ages, including college and vocational education
- To have the same legal rights as people without disabilities
- To be free from the fear of Medicaid & Social Security cuts and have sufficient budgets that support each individual’s needs
- To be allowed to accumulate wealth and plan for retirement without fear of losing benefits
- To have recreational opportunities in the community
- To build civic/social capital
